P0340-CAMSHAFT POSITION SENSOR CIRCUIT





For a complete wiring diagram Refer to Section 8W



Possible Causes
 
(K844) CMP 5-VOLT SUPPLY CIRCUIT OPEN
 
(K44) CAMSHAFT POSITION SENSOR SIGNAL CIRCUIT SHORTED TO VOLTAGE
 
(K944) CAMSHAFT POSITION SENSOR GROUND CIRCUIT SHORTED TO VOLTAGE
 
CHECKING (K844) CMP 5-VOLT SUPPLY CIRCUIT
 
DAMAGED CMP SENSOR OR CAMSHAFT
 
ECM
 
(K944) CMP SENSOR GROUND CIRCUIT OPEN
 
INTERMITTENT CONDITION
 
(K44) CMP SENSOR SIGNAL CIRCUIT OPEN
 
(K844) CMP 5-VOLT SUPPLY CIRCUIT SHORTED TO GROUND
 
(K44) CMP SENSOR SIGNAL CIRCUIT SHORTED TO GROUND
 
CAMSHAFT POSITION SENSOR
 
(K844) CMP 5-VOLT SUPPLY CIRCUIT SHORTED TO THE (K944) CMP SENSOR GROUND CIRCUIT
 
(K44) CMP SENSOR SIGNAL CIRCUIT SHORTED TO THE (K944) CMP SENSOR GROUND CIRCUIT
 


Always perform the Pre-Diagnostic Troubleshooting procedure before proceeding. (Refer to 9 - ENGINE - DIAGNOSIS AND TESTING)



Diagnostic Test

1. VERIFY ACTIVE DTC

NOTE: If DTC P0642 or P0643 is present with this DTC, diagnose DTCs P0642 or P0643 before diagnosing this DTC.


NOTE: The Timing Belt/Chain must be correctly installed and operational before diagnosis can be made. Refer to the Service Information to ensure the timing belt is properly installed.


NOTE: If the ECM detects and stores a DTC, the ECM also stores the engine/vehicle operating conditions under which the DTC was set. Some of these conditions are displayed on the scan tool at the same time the DTC is displayed.


NOTE: Before erasing stored DTCs, record these conditions. Attempting to duplicate these conditions may assist when checking for an active DTC.


Turn the ignition on.
With the scan tool, erase the ECM DTCs.
Attempt to start the engine cranking the engine for at least 7 seconds.
With the scan tool, read the ECM DTCs.

Does the scan tool display this DTC?

3. CHECKING (K44) CAMSHAFT POSITION SENSOR SIGNAL CIRCUIT



Turn the ignition off.
Disconnect the Camshaft Position Sensor harness connector.
Turn the ignition on.
Measure the voltage of the (K44) CMP Sensor Signal circuit at the CMP Sensor harness connector.

Select the appropriate voltage reading.

Voltage is above 5.4 volts.


Voltage is between 4.7 and 5.4 volts.


Voltage is below 4.7 volts.

4. (K44) CAMSHAFT POSITION SENSOR SIGNAL CIRCUIT SHORT TO VOLTAGE



Turn the ignition off.
Disconnect the ECM harness connectors.
Remove the Main Relay.
Connect a jumper wire between cavity B7 and cavity B9 of the Main Relay connector.
Turn the ignition on.
Measure the voltage of the (K44) CMP Position Sensor Signal circuit at the CMP Sensor harness connector.
Measure the voltage of the (K944) CMP Position Sensor Ground circuit at the CMP Sensor harness connector.

Is the voltage below 1.0 volt for each measurement?

6. (K944) CAMSHAFT POSITION SENSOR GROUND CIRCUIT OPEN



Turn the ignition on.
Disconnect the ECT Sensor harness connector.
Connect one end of a jumper wire to the (K2) ECT Sensor signal circuit in the ECT Sensor harness connector.
Connect the other end of the jumper wire to the (K944) CMP Sensor Ground circuit in the Camshaft Position Sensor harness connector.
With the scan tool in Engine, Sensors, read the Engine Coolant Temp volts.

Is the voltage below 0.5 volt?

7. (K944) CAMSHAFT POSITION SENSOR GROUND CIRCUIT OPEN



Turn the ignition off.
Disconnect the CMP Sensor harness connector.
Disconnect the ECM harness connectors.
Measure the resistance of the (K944) CMP Sensor Ground circuit between the CMP Sensor harness connector and the ECM harness connector.

Is the resistance below 10.0 ohms?

8. DAMAGED CAMSHAFT POSITION SENSOR OR CAMSHAFT

Turn the ignition off.
Remove the CMP Sensor.
Inspect the CMP Sensor for conditions such as loose mounting screws, damage, or cracks.
Inspect the camshaft for conditions such as damage, debris or cracked teeth.

Is there any evidence of these conditions?

9. (K844) CAMSHAFT POSITION SENSOR 5-VOLT SUPPLY CIRCUIT OPEN



Turn the ignition off.
Disconnect the ECM harness connectors.
Measure the resistance of the (K844) CMP 5-Volt Supply circuit between the ECM harness connector and the CMP Sensor harness connector.

Is the resistance below 10.0 ohms?
